Concourse Way is in Sheffield and in Sheffield district. S1 2BJ is located in the City elect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Sheffield Central. This postcode has been in use since 2009-01-01.

In the UK, the overall gender distribution is approximately 49% male and 51% female. The area surrounding S1 2BJ has a slightly higher male population, with 52.8% of residents being male. Several factors can contribute to this, including areas with industries or sectors that predominantly employ men, proximity to universities or technical schools with a higher enrollment of male students, presence of all-male or predominantly male institutions (military academies, boarding schools).

Across the UK, the average relationship status breakdown is roughly 44% married, 38% single, 9% divorced, 6% widowed, and 2% separated.
In the immediate area around S1 2BJ, a significant portion of the population is single, making up 60.9% of the residents. On average, approximately 38% of individuals who responded to the census in the UK were single. Areas with higher single populations are typically urban centers, university towns, regions with dynamic job markets, rich cultural offerings and entertainment facilities. These regions also tend to have a younger demographic.

Across the UK, the average 48.4% rated their health as Very Good, 33.6% as Good, 12.7% as Fair, 4% as Bad, and 1.2% as Very Bad.
Population age significantly impacts residents' health. Additionally, socioeconomic status plays a crucial role: higher income levels and lower poverty rates are linked to better health outcomes. Affluent areas benefit from higher living standards, access to private healthcare, and healthier lifestyle choices.
This area has a high percentage of residents reporting their health as Good or Very Good (86.8%) compared to the average (82%). This typically indicates either a younger population or more affluent area.

During the 2021 census, the educational qualifications of residents across the UK were as follows: 18.2% had no qualifications, 9.6% had 1-4 GCSEs, 13.4% had 5 or more GCSEs and 1-2 A/AS Levels, 16.9% had 2 or more A Levels, 33.8% held a degree (or equivalent), and 5.4% had completed an apprenticeship.
In the area around S1 2BJ this area, 9.9% of residents have no qualifications. This is significantly lower than the UK average of 18.2%. This area stands out for its high percentage of residents with higher education degree or similar. The UK average is 33.8%, while in this area it is 51.1%.

Over the last 12 months, the overall crime rate around Concourse Way was 620.8 per 1,000 residents, which is 93.7% higher than the City average. The most reported crime type was Violence and sexual offences.
Concourse Way has the 5th highest crime rate of 121 local areas in City and the 31st highest crime rate of 1,705 local areas in Sheffield .
Violent and sexual offences accounted for around 246.6 crimes per 1,000 residents and have been falling year on year. Over the last decade, overall crime has fallen by about -32.3%.

Households in this area have a lower level of wealth compared to the average household in England and Wales. 86% of analyzed areas in England and Wales have higher average household annual income than this area.
